I thought of a few more things...

We enjoyed the character breakfasts. Even though we are not huge breakfast eaters at home and they are a little pricey, the days we did them, we really only had a snack at lunch time, then had an early dinner (which is cheaper anyway) and then a late snack, so I THINK we saved money doing it that way. Our shopping trip saved us quite a bit too in the snack area. We could easily be happy with a granola bar and banana for a snack, but without them would have spent $5 each on something in the park. Definately buy botteled water at the grocery store.

I have not satyed at Port Orleans, but have heard it is nice. Keep in mind, with the discount codes, this fall, Wilderness Lodge standard view was around $129/night. I think the moderates were around $109, so not a huge difference.
